Kernel BO's aren't exposed to UM, so labelling them is the responsibility
of the driver itself. This kind of tagging will prove useful in further
commits when want to expose these objects through DebugFS.
Expand panthor_kernel_bo_create() interface to take a NUL-terminated
string. No bounds checking is done because all label strings are given
as statically-allocated literals, but if a more complex kernel BO naming
scheme with explicit memory allocation and formatting was desired in the
future, this would have to change.

Add a device DebugFS file that displays a complete list of all the DRM
GEM objects that are exposed to UM through a DRM handle.
Since leaking object identifiers that might belong to a different NS is
inadmissible, this functionality is only made available in debug builds
with DEBUGFS support enabled.
File format is that of a table, with each entry displaying a variety of
fields with information about each GEM object.
Each GEM object entry in the file displays the following information
fields: Client PID, BO's global name, reference count, BO virtual size,
BO resize size, VM address in its DRM-managed range, BO label and a GEM
state flags.
There's also a usage flags field for the type of BO, which tells us
whether it's a kernel BO and/or mapped onto the FW's address space.

This patch series is aimed at providing UM with detailed memory profiling
information in debug builds. It is achieved through a device-wide list of
DRM GEM objects, and also implementing the ability to label BO's from UM
through a new IOCTL.
The new debugfs file shows a list of driver DRM GEM objects in tabular mode.
To visualise it, cat sudo cat /sys/kernel/debug/dri/*.gpu/gems.

Funny that this one pops up just after I fixed a missing-padding-field
issue in panthor_drm.h. We really need to tool based on pahole to
detect those before merging.
